Leak detection in Benoni — what we actually find
Around Benoni's lakeside suburbs roots that have found a sewer joint will find a supply joint on the same property, and mature planting hides the result for months. We pressure-test by section rather than excavating on guesswork. Where a cottage or back rooms have been added, the extended supply run to that accommodation is frequently the least documented part of the installation.
Property stock in Benoni
Benoni's established suburbs around the lakes have mature gardens and original clay sewer lines, which is the combination that produces root intrusion. Rodding clears the symptom for a season; relining or replacing the affected length is what ends it. Many homes have had a cottage or back rooms added and fed from the main house without a properly protected sub-main.

Faults that cluster in Benoni
- Root intrusion into original clay sewer lines beneath mature gardens
- Blockages returning each season because the pipe, not the debris, is the problem
- Cottages and back rooms fed from the main house without a protected sub-main
- Added accommodation with no dedicated earth leakage of its own
How leak detection works
The meter test tells you whether you have a leak; detection tells you where it is. Close every tap, note the reading, wait two hours and read again — any movement means water is escaping between the meter and your fixtures. From there, acoustic correlation and thermal imaging locate it precisely enough to repair without opening tiles speculatively. That precision is the whole point, because the repair is usually small and the exploratory damage is what costs.
- Acoustic and thermal detection on supply lines, including under slabs and paving
- Toilet and cistern dye testing, which finds the most commonly missed silent leak
- Irrigation, pool and buried supply-line isolation testing
- Written reports with marked locations for insurance and municipal leak adjustments
- Repair of the located leak, or re-routing where the buried run is at end of life
Our process on a Benoni call-out
- 1Confirm an active leak with a meter isolation test before any equipment comes out
- 2Isolate zone by zone — toilets, irrigation, pool, house — to narrow the area
- 3Pinpoint with acoustic correlation and thermal imaging
- 4Mark the location and report it in writing with the position recorded
- 5Repair with a targeted break-out rather than exploratory demolition
